RQI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review
81 of the 3,582 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cohen & Steers Quality Income Realty Fund (RQI)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$223M — up 6.9% from $209M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 16 funds closed out of RQI and 10 opened new positions — a net loss of 6 holders — while 23 trimmed existing stakes and 24 added.
The largest buyer was Bank of Nova Scotia, opening a new position worth an estimated $4.53M. The largest seller was Clough Capital Partners, exiting entirely with an estimated $3.84M sold.
